One of these bounties is Jatropha, the physic nut. It is one of the most popular herbs and the term Jatropha is really a "genus" covering some 175 plants together. The name originates from Greek words for physician and trophe significance nutrition. So physic nuts or Jatropha, from the kingdom plantae is being studied widely for it can be put to lots of usages in our day-to-day lives.

To begin with, jatropha curcas is discovering great approval all over the world as a bio-doesel. The jatropha curcas seeds can be crushed to get the oil and this can be used as a bio-fuel. The residues can be used as fertilizer or as a feed for electrical energy creating plants. And this enables a sustainable advancement. Not just the seeds, however the plant as a whole is well suited to fulfill the growing environmental concerns. And why simply the bio-diesel, it can be used as aviation fuel, car fuel and a host of other usages from other parts of the plants. The stems of this plant discover usages in basket making, ornamental functions, and tanning leather and obtaining dyes. The plant even finds use in medicines for cough, balm ointments, tooth pastes, cosmetics and is even used to produce good quality paper. But it is not all gift - gift about the plant. The jatropha curcas plant has poisonous content. It has lectin, saponin, phorbol, toxalbumin curcin and is a trypsin inhibitor. In easy words, it can be hazardous and in extreme conditions, even deadly to take in untreated plant. The seeds need to be properly roasted and treated before being utilized in any consumable use.
